“We are being left in some kind of void.” - Margaret O’Hara, Trustee, Long Covid Support

BBC News North East & Cumbria reports the region’s last dedicated Long Covid clinics are due to close this month.

Vitamin B12 deficiency is often overlooked, yet may contribute to symptoms in Long Covid and ME/CFS.

In this episode, Dr Binita Kane, Dr Andrew Klein and Helen Oakleigh discuss how B12 deficiency can be missed and what evidence-based treatment looks like.

The Long Covid groups are calling for:

1. Proper data on how Long Covid affects work and income
2. Economic and welfare policies that reflect the realities of Long Covid
3. Lived experience to be built into decision-making
